Wizard World Chicago has cancelled the 2020 convention that was scheduled for August 20-23. The long running convention will return to Chicago on June 24-27, 2021, a bit earlier in the summer than the con is usually held.
Tickets that were purchased for the August convention can be used for the rescheduled dates.
Since Wizard World has cancelled several of their conventions in 2020 due to concerns surrounding COVID-19, they have shared the dates for multiple 2021 shows earlier than usual. New Orleans will be held on January 8-10, Philadelphia on January 15-17, Portland on January 29-31, Cleveland on February 26-28, St. Louis on March 12-14, and then Chicago.
